"A Stoic is a Buddhist with attitude" How do you not just survive in chaos, but benefit from it? In this podcast, Caleb and Michael review Nassim Taleb's book "Antifragile." In it, Taleb describes a Stoic philosophy grounded in the realities of randomness and practice. They talk about how ideas from this book have impacted them – and the questions of theory and practice that remain.
